Interesting that it sails from Venice. Guess they are anticipating that Venice will relax their requirements on ship size - unless they are really sailing from Marghera...EM

 

I think MSC Seaside will sail from Trieste and not Venice:

 

http://www.mscfans.it/2016/04/22/fes...e-msc-seaside/

 

Yesterday, on the sidelines of the Coin Ceremony MSC Seaside held in Monfalcone, the Executive Chairman of MSC Pierfrancesco Vago has released a short but interesting interview with a local journalist by leaking the news that the ship before leaving Italy and from for positioning cruise to Miami it will be hosted by the port of Trieste. It is not clear whether it will be also the port of departure of the cruise, in place of Venice, as posted on the new catalog.

 

In the article in which we have dealt with the theme of "vernissage" Cruise had drawn to the problem of a departure from Venice for well-known vicissitudes related to the passage of ships from the basin of San Marco and then the choice of Trieste we seemed the most plausible, moreover adopted by other companies.

When asked by a journalist on a future switch to Trieste MSC ships, Vago responds by citing a promise made to local institutions, in particular the Governor of the Region, a big party in Trieste for the delivery of the ship, a kind of Italian that will precede baptism to Miami, to give the opportunity to the city, to the families of the workers and those who have contributed to the realization of Seaside to see the "jewel" built and his departure to the United States.

 

Then meet in Trieste to the end of November 2017? Maybe. We will keep you updated as always on the developments.
